WIRE โ€” A fresh wave of internal distrust has reportedly engulfed the leadership of the Islamic State West Africa Province (ISWAP) in the Lake Chad Basin, following the arrest and detention of four senior members of the group's influential Shura Council by its overall leader in the area, Ba Shuwa.
